Because sometimes you just have to say "screw it."For the uninitiated a Wendy's Frosty is a thick and delectable soft serve ice cream/milkshake that's great by itself and even better as part of a fast food meal. Frostys, believe it or not, serve as fantastic dips for Wendy's french fries.
The Vanilla Frosty has a lot going for it. Firstly, it has a fantastic burst of initial flavor. For something you get from a national fast food chain the Frosty catches you by surprise with its smooth vanilla taste. However I found the texture to be a double-edged sword. It's thick enough to justify eating with a spoon yet the Frosty dissolves quickly in your mouth. I don't like how quickly the soft serve melts and becomes soupy rather quick.
Click here for the nutrition facts and ingredients. A small Vanilla Frosty contains 310 calories, 8 grams of fat (5 saturated) and a whopping 43 grams of sugar. Benefits include good amounts of Vitamin A and calcium.
Wendy's Vanilla Frosty, while not the most decadent of desserts, is a solid purchase for anyone who likes frozen treats. It's currently on the Super Value Menu for a limited time. One dollar for a 12-ounce Frosty? That's a flat out bargain.
